a亚洲精品_精品国产91乱码一区二区三区_亚洲精品在线免费观看视频_欧美日韩亚洲国产综合_久久久久久久久久久成人_在线区

首頁 > 學(xué)院 > 編程設(shè)計(jì) > 正文

使用vscode 編輯調(diào)試php 配置方與VSCode斷點(diǎn)調(diào)試PHP

2020-06-27 13:59:01
字體:
供稿:網(wǎng)友

以前的php調(diào)試工具,類似zendstudio 或者phpclipse,storm運(yùn)行太慢了,還是這個(gè)好用。
 

 

軟件名稱:
Visual Studio Code 64位 v1.21.1 官方最新安裝版
軟件大小:
43MB
更新時(shí)間:
2018-04-04

 

1、首先官網(wǎng)下載vs code  地址:https://code.visualstudio.com/,下載后直接安裝即可。 

2、安裝擴(kuò)展php-debug安裝步驟見 https://marketplace.visualstudio.com/items?itemName=felixfbecker.php-debug

具體為:按ctl+shif+x 或者點(diǎn) 紅色的“擴(kuò)展標(biāo)簽“ , 輸入xdebug即可安裝
 

vscode,編輯,調(diào)試php
 

3、在菜單欄: 文件--》首選項(xiàng)--》配置 
 

vscode,編輯,調(diào)試php
 

彈出下面窗口,然后將   "php.validate.executablePath": "D:/usr/local/php.exe" 添加進(jìn)去

// 將設(shè)置放入此文件中以覆蓋默認(rèn)設(shè)置  {      "php.validate.executablePath": "D:/usr/local/php/php.exe",      "editor.fontSize": 12    }

4、必須先打開您的php項(xiàng)目目錄,然后才能設(shè)置debug

vscode,編輯,調(diào)試php
 

1.點(diǎn)擊齒輪,選擇php--》選擇listen for xdebug

 (配置文件內(nèi)容不需要?jiǎng)樱?/p>

vscode,編輯,調(diào)試php
 


 

5、打開php文件,在指定行按F9設(shè)置斷點(diǎn), 然后啟動(dòng)調(diào)試。

     測試配置是否正確,可以在cmd窗口,執(zhí)行netstat -an 看本機(jī)是否有監(jiān)聽 9000端口。
 

6、訪問可調(diào)試網(wǎng)頁
 

附錄:   

vs code 修改快捷鍵綁定: 文件--》首選項(xiàng)--》 鍵盤快捷方式  [{      "key": "f8",      "command": "workbench.action.debug.stepOver",      "when": "inDebugMode"  },{      "key": "f7",      "command": "workbench.action.debug.stepInto",      "when": "inDebugMode"  }  ] 


 

VSCode斷點(diǎn)調(diào)試PHP

 今天突然要寫一點(diǎn)PHP的小東西,多層次嵌套,邏輯有點(diǎn)復(fù)雜,之前一直都是打日志的方式來調(diào)試的,本來我們.Neter都是被VS慣壞了的人,于是就在VSCode里面來試試給PHP加上Debug

 1 . 安裝PHPStudy這個(gè)集成環(huán)境包

 

軟件名稱:
phpStudy 2018( PHP運(yùn)行環(huán)境安裝包) for Linux 官方版+完整版(附安裝方法)
軟件大小:
128MB
更新時(shí)間:
2018-02-28

 

vscode,編輯,調(diào)試php

啟動(dòng)apache服務(wù)器,然后 ->其他選項(xiàng)菜單->My HomePages 輸入PHPInfo
找到PHP的版本安裝目錄 找到XDebug,沒有的話,就加上這個(gè)標(biāo)簽

[XDebug]
xdebug.profiler_output_dir="D:/phpStudy/tmp/xdebug"
xdebug.trace_output_dir="D:/phpStudy/tmp/xdebug"
zend_extension="D:/phpStudy/php/php-5.6.27-nts/ext/php_xdebug.dll"
xdebug.remote_enable = 1
xdebug.remote_autostart = 1

 畫一個(gè)重點(diǎn)啊,最后兩句一定要加上,切記切記,不加應(yīng)該進(jìn)不了斷點(diǎn)

然后就是VSCode,去官網(wǎng)下載安裝好,然后再商店搜索這個(gè)三個(gè)插件

vscode,編輯,調(diào)試php

然后就可以開始調(diào)試你的PHP代碼了,F(xiàn)5走起。。。。

然后還是跑不起來對(duì)不?

最后還要在VS里面加上PHP的路徑,

vscode,編輯,調(diào)試php

這下按調(diào)試應(yīng)該可以運(yùn)行了吧。。。不管你是否可以,反正我是可以了

vscode,編輯,調(diào)試php


發(fā)表評(píng)論 共有條評(píng)論
用戶名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 成人欧美一区二区三区在线湿哒哒 | 日韩精品一区二区三区中文在线 | 精品国产乱码久久久久久1区2区 | 日韩欧美三区 | 久久久久av| 91.com在线 | 日韩一区二区在线电影 | 成人日韩 | 亚洲精品66 | 久久久久久久一区 | 欧美色综合| 97超碰人人在线 | 污网站在线浏览 | 亚洲精品一区二区三区 | 狠狠色狠狠色合久久伊人 | 日本好好热视频 | 暖暖视频日韩欧美在线观看 | 国产精品日本一区二区不卡视频 | 亚洲三区在线观看 | 国产乱码精品一区二区 | 呦呦av在线 | 亚洲视频在线看 | 成人精品在线 | 欧美一级成人欧美性视频播放 | 亚洲国产精品精华液com | 日韩一区二区免费视频 | 国内精品国产三级国产在线专 | 美日韩在线 | 一级一级特黄女人精品毛片 | 国产小视频在线 | 国产在线中文字幕 | 91精品综合久久久久久五月天 | 欧美日韩亚洲国产 | 99久久99久久免费精品蜜臀 | 亚洲精品蜜桃 | 国产第3页 | 国产视频精品一区二区三区 | 中文字幕影院 | 操操操夜夜操 | 欧美日韩电影一区二区 | 精品一区免费 |